According to the public record, 20, Coleridge Close, Bridgend is a modern freehold house with 505 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 210 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 2 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 20, Coleridge Close, Bridgend is £164,267 and the estimated rental value is £1,089 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 20, Coleridge Close, Bridgend is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£172,480 and a rental value of £1,143 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£152,768 and a rental value of £1,013 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 20 Coleridge Close Bridgend has increased by an estimated £4,676 (2.8%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£52 per month (4.8%), giving an expected gross yield of 8%.

20, Coleridge Close, Bridgend has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 01 Feb 2024.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 20, Coleridge Close, Bridgend was last sold on 4th October 2011 for £80,500 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since October 2011, the market for similar properties has risen 78.1%
